  • Page 11: General

    WIPLINE MODEL 8000 SERVICE MANUAL 1.0 GENERAL The model 8000 seaplane or amphibious float is an all aluminum constructed float with watertight compartments. The actual displacement in fresh water for each float is 8108 pounds buoyancy for the seaplane and 7922 pounds buoyancy for the amphibian.
  • Page 12: Float Hull Maintenance

    WIPLINE MODEL 8000 SERVICE MANUAL 2.0 FLOAT HULL MAINTENANCE 2.1 GENERAL The float structure is manufactured entirely of 6061-T6 corrosion resistant aluminum sheet and extrusions. Skins on the inside are primed with a 3M SCOTCHWELD primer after being cleaned and acid-etched. Exterior surfaces are cleaned and alodined.
  • Page 13 WIPLINE MODEL 8000 SERVICE MANUAL Cleaning The outside of the float should be kept clean by washing with soap and water. Special care should be taken to remove engine exhaust trails, waterline marks, and barnacle deposits. After saltwater operation, washing with fresh water should be done daily with special attention to hard-to-reach places such as: seams, wheel wells, etc.
  • Page 14 WIPLINE MODEL 8000 SERVICE MANUAL Corrosion Corrosion is a reaction that destroys metal by an electrochemical action that converts metal to oxide. Corrosion is accelerated when in contact with dissimilar metals such as aluminum and steel, or any material that absorbs moisture like wood, rubber, or dirt. After removing the corroded area, restore area to original finish (prime and enamel).

  • Page 16: Amphibian Landing Gear System Operation & Maintenance

    WIPLINE MODEL 8000 SERVICE MANUAL 4.0 AMPHIBIAN LANDING GEAR SYSTEM OPERATION & MAINTENANCE The landing gear incorporated within the amphibious floats on this airplane is retractable, quadricycle type with two swiveling nose (or bow) wheels and four (4) (two (2) sets of dual) main wheels. Air-oil shock struts on the two main landing gear assemblies provide shock absorption.

  • Page 18: Main And Nose Gear Operation, Removal And Service

    WIPLINE MODEL 8000 SERVICE MANUAL 5.0 MAIN AND NOSE GEAR OPERATION, REMOVAL AND SERVICE 5.1 DESCRIPTION AND OPERATION Retraction and extension of the main and nose landing gear is effected by a hydraulic actuation system shown schematically in figure 5.3. The gear system is hydraulically actuated and driven by two hydraulic pumps located in the Aft fuselage.

  • Page 32: Hydraulic Pump System, Disassembly And Service

    WIPLINE MODEL 8000 SERVICE MANUAL 5.5 HYDRAULIC PUMP SYSTEM, DISASSEMBLY AND SERVICE The hydraulic pump is factory preset to the following pressures: Pressures switch operates below 500 psi and shuts off at 1000 psi. The pump also has an internal relief valve that opens at 1200 psi and a thermal relief valve that opens at 1900 psi.

  • Page 51: Water Rudder Retraction And Steering System

    WIPLINE MODEL 8000 SERVICE MANUAL 6.0 WATER RUDDER RETRACTION AND STEERING SYSTEM 6.1 DESCRIPTION The water rudder-retract system is manually operated by a lever through a system of cables and pulleys. Steering is directed from the aircraft rudder steering system. 6.2 ADJUSTMENT Rigging of the water rudder steering cables is accomplished by centering the airplane rudder and adjusting the turnbuckles such that both rudders trail with the float center line.
